Abstract
Diverse solar energy applications are being demonstrated in research projects launched by the Energy Research Institute at the King Abdulaziz City for Science & Technology, Saudi Arabia. Experiences gained to date with a 350 kW photovoltaic village project, solar-drive water desalination schemes, 350 kW solar hydrogen production system, and solar water heating units are summarized. Guidelines for future research and improvements are based on lessons learned. Extensive studies are needed to reduce component costs, increase conversion efficiencies, and improve sociocultural acceptance rates.
